Crispy Cauliflower Cakes with Herb Sauce and Arugula Salad

Ingredients
Cakes:
12 oz cauliflower florets
1 (10 oz) peeled baked potato, cut into 4 slices
2 large shallots, halved lengthwise
1 ½ t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
2 ounces grated fontina cheese (about 1/2 cup)
½ teaspoon chopped fresh thyme
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
1 large egg, lightly beaten
½ cup panko (Japanese breadcrumbs), lightly toasted
2 tablespoons grated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ese
Sauce:
2 tablespoons light sour cream
2 tablespoons canola mayonnaise (like Hellmann's)
2 teaspoons chopped fresh flat-leaved parsley
2 teaspoons chopped fresh green onions
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
1 clove garlic, minced
Salad:
4 cups fresh arugula
½ cup halved grape tomatoes
2 teaspoons extra virgin olive oil
1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
To make
To toast the panko, place it in a large skillet and cook over medium heat for 3 minutes or until it is lightly browned, stirring frequently.
Preheat the oven to 400 degrees.To make the patties, place the cauliflower, potatoes, and shallots on a baking sheet. Drizzle the vegetables with 1 1/2 tablespoons of oil; toss to combine. Bake at 400 ° C for 35 minutes or until cooked through, stirring once. Place the cauliflower mixture in a food processor; chop 10 times or until it is crushed. Transfer the mixture to a bowl. Add the minced meat, thyme, salt, 1/2 teaspoon pepper and egg, mixing well.Combine panko and parmesan reggiano in a shallow bowl. With wet hands, shape the cauliflower mixture into 8 patties (1-inch thick); roll in the panko mixture. Place the patties on a baking sheet. Bake at 400 ° C for 25 minutes or until they are lightly browned, turning once.To make the sauce, combine the sour cream and the following 5 ingredients (with the addition of garlic) in a small bowl.To make the salad, combine the arugula, tomatoes, 2 teaspoons of oil and juice; mix well to coat. Place 1 cup of the arugula mixture on each of the 4 plates; top with 2 brownies and 1 tablespoon of the herb sauce.
